It's that time of year again, folks; excitement, anticipation, sweaty palms - yes, it's time to choose the next Waterbowl Legacy team!

We've had some great teams in the past and we've still got plenty of races to choose from this time around. I've created a poll with the choices and once the poll is closed we'll move on to allocating miniatures to those that want to be involved. There'll be more on that later.

There is also the matter of colour scheme, so as well as voting on the race you can put your colour scheme suggestions in this thread and I'll take an average, or a new scheme that we haven't had before or just choose my favourite combination :)

The Legacy team is a prize team won by a coach who both attends the Waterbowl tournament in February 2018 and also submits a painted miniature for the team. All those coaches who participate have their name put into a hat and the first name drawn out wins the team!
In previous years the winner has then graciously used the Legacy team in the tournament (but that is by no means enforced, except by ruthless jibes and rotten vegetables and a 50 point penalty ;) ).
